Output 16754f4f5e1089f76583c03a3a90a42844b8d730da5cd9c4e11436ecaf8813b6:3

value
63331381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ede9d64ce757ecd6d2222999ea68f6e6740fd3b1 OP_EQUAL
address
MVb8WBU9dQ7xtDQN8grpxXTaZci3EB4w9z
transaction
16754f4f5e1089f76583c03a3a90a42844b8d730da5cd9c4e11436ecaf8813b6
spent
true